According to the World Health Organization, over 422 million people worldwide live with diabetes, a number steadily rising due to changing diets and lifestyles. Blood sugar disorders often develop silently, making early detection critical for prevention. The endocrine system, especially the pancreas, plays a vital role in regulating blood glucose through insulin production. Unfortunately, many cases go undiagnosed until complications arise. Recognizing foods that may elevate blood sugar is essential for maintaining metabolic health and reducing the risk of diabetes and other endocrine-related conditions.
